Gallery of Caversham Snow 9th January 2010

9th January 2010 afternoon visit to allotment, to get vegetables. We can see what problems farmers are having. The snow seemed deeper over here, and difficult to find the crops.

Under some of this snow there are carrots, parsnips and leeks. Quite a lot of plants, like leeks were bending over under the weight of snow. Many had to be found by removing lots of snow first.
